How Agricultural Chemicals Affect the Lifespan of Your Roof

How Agricultural Chemicals Affect the Lifespan of Your Roof

1- Introduction to Roof Lifespan and Agricultural Chemicals

The lifespan of a roof is influenced by several factors, from weather conditions to the materials used in its construction. One of the often-overlooked factors that can significantly impact the durability of a roof is exposure to agricultural chemicals. Farms and agricultural businesses frequently use pesticides, herbicides, and fertilizers that can cause wear and tear on the roofing materials over time. Understanding how these chemicals affect your roof and how to mitigate their effects is essential for homeowners living near agricultural areas.

2- Roof Materials and Their Durability

Different roofing materials have varying lifespans and resistance to external factors, including agricultural chemicals. Let’s take a closer look at some common roofing materials and their ability to withstand chemical exposure:

2.1 Asphalt Shingles

Asphalt shingles are a popular roofing material due to their affordability and ease of installation. However, they can be particularly vulnerable to agricultural chemicals. Pesticides and herbicides can break down the protective oils in asphalt shingles, leading to premature aging, cracking, and blistering.

2.2 Metal Roofing

Metal roofs are known for their durability and resistance to weathering, but they aren’t immune to damage from agricultural chemicals. Over time, chemical exposure can cause rust and corrosion on the metal surface, especially if the roof isn’t properly coated or maintained.

2.3 Tile Roofing

Tile roofing is more resistant to the elements than asphalt shingles, but it can still suffer from the effects of long-term exposure to chemicals. While the tiles themselves may not degrade as quickly, the mortar and sealants that hold them in place can be compromised, leading to leaks and structural issues.

2.4 Slate and Wood Shingles

Slate roofs are durable and have a long lifespan, but they can be vulnerable to the buildup of chemicals that damage the surface over time. Wood shingles are particularly susceptible to chemical damage, as the chemicals can cause the wood to rot and decay, leading to a decrease in lifespan.

3- How Agricultural Chemicals Impact Roof Lifespan

Agricultural chemicals can have a direct impact on the physical properties of roofing materials, causing them to deteriorate more quickly. Here are some key ways agricultural chemicals affect the lifespan of a roof:

3.1 Chemical Degradation of Roofing Materials

Pesticides, herbicides, and fertilizers contain chemicals that can break down the oils, resins, and other protective coatings in roofing materials. This results in accelerated aging, cracking, and fading. For example, a roof exposed to pesticide spraying may lose its ability to shed water effectively, leading to water infiltration and potential leaks.

3.2 Chemical Corrosion

Metal roofing, in particular, is prone to corrosion when exposed to certain agricultural chemicals. Fertilizers and pesticides that contain high levels of salt can cause metal roofs to rust over time. This corrosion weakens the structural integrity of the roof, leading to potential leaks and the need for costly repairs or replacement.

3.3 Mold and Mildew Growth

Some agricultural chemicals, particularly fungicides and herbicides, can promote mold and mildew growth on your roof. This is especially true if the chemicals are applied regularly and create a damp environment that fosters mold growth. Mold can cause significant damage to roofing materials, leading to rot and structural issues.

4- Preventive Measures to Protect Roofs from Agricultural Chemicals

While agricultural chemicals are inevitable in some areas, there are steps homeowners can take to minimize the impact of these chemicals on their roof:

4.1 Regular Roof Inspections

Conducting regular roof inspections is one of the most effective ways to spot early signs of damage caused by chemicals. Check for signs of wear, such as cracking, discoloration, or corrosion. Regular inspections help catch problems before they become major issues, saving you time and money in the long run.

4.2 Applying Protective Coatings

One way to protect your roof from chemical damage is to apply a protective coating. For metal roofs, a high-quality coating can provide an extra layer of defense against rust and corrosion. For asphalt shingles, using a protective sealant can help preserve the integrity of the shingles and prevent chemical degradation.

4.3 Installing Chemical Barriers

In some cases, it may be possible to install barriers that prevent chemicals from reaching your roof. These barriers could be physical structures, like screens or shields, or they could involve planting vegetation that absorbs chemicals before they make contact with the roof.

5- When to Replace Your Roof Due to Chemical Exposure

Even with preventive measures in place, there comes a point when the damage caused by agricultural chemicals is too severe to repair. Here are some signs that it might be time to replace your roof:

5.1 Extensive Damage to Roof Materials

If your roof shows significant signs of wear due to chemical exposure, such as widespread rust, corrosion, or cracks in the material, it may be time to consider replacement. While patching up isolated spots is possible, replacing the entire roof ensures your home remains protected.

5.2 Persistent Leaks

If your roof begins leaking in multiple areas, especially after exposure to agricultural chemicals, it might be a sign that the roof has been compromised. Leaks can lead to further damage to your home’s interior and pose a risk to your health, making replacement the safest option.

5.3 Decreased Energy Efficiency

A damaged roof can reduce the energy efficiency of your home. Gaps or deteriorated shingles can allow air to escape, causing your heating and cooling systems to work harder. If your energy bills are consistently high despite maintaining the roof, it may be time for a new roof installation.
